Thanking our summer intern, Ei

Over the weekend, we said goodbye to our intern Ei. Ei came to RCI through his church, Whitehall Mennonite. He interned at our Community Building Center, where he helped in the kitchen and with community building activities. “I like the people here, hearing about their experiences. I learned to approach people, communicate and make connections.” We’re grateful to Ei for spending his summer with us, and for all the help he provided – always with a smile - during his time at RCI.

Ei (left) with a community member in the CBC.

Ei (far right) with members of Whitehall Mennonite Church, hosting a Christmas in June party in the CBC.

Ei will be attending Drexel University in the Fall to study engineering. We wish him the best of luck!

Celebrating our Community Stars

Last week, the Lehigh Valley IronPigs honored RCI Volunteers Sue Karpovich and Jody Smith as 2024 United Federal Credit Union Community Stars!

We are forever grateful to Sue and Jody for their dedication as volunteers to RCI. These two extraordinary human beings have been volunteering at our Community Building Center every week for over six years. They have served countless meals. They have hung wallpaper and assembled furniture. They made sure our community members never had to go without, even at the height of the COVID pandemic. They loaned us their grill for a community event and didn’t get mad when we somehow caught the whole thing on fire. But most importantly, they have loved and cared for our community, and they have done it with joy and gusto. Our staff and community members are lucky to call them our friends, and humbled to know that the feeling is mutual. Thank you, Sue and Jody, from all of us at Ripple Community Inc.!

Thank you to our new partner!

We are excited to share that we have a new partnership with translationservices.com. They will be providing in-kind services to us as part of their mission of supporting resource providers for people experiencing homelessness. This partnership will help us to be welcoming and inclusive to better serve our evolving and diverse community. Thank you, translationservices.com!
